CourtReserve Calendar Feed

How to set up a CourtReserve digital calendar feed

Note: Your personal digital calendar must support “subscriptions” or “feeds” that allow you to add a calendar using a URL. Most current versions of Google, Apple, Outlook, and many other calendar programs support this feature.

Where to Get Your CourtReserve Calendar Feed Link

If you're using the CourtReserve Mobile app:

  1. Tap More in the bottom-right corner.

  2. Tap Calendar Feed.

  3. Select from the following options:

    1. Copy Link - Copies the calendar feed URL to your clipboard, allowing you to paste it into your calendar program.

    2. Email Link - Sends the calendar feed URL to your email address on file.

If you're using CourtReserve from your desktop or tablet:

  1. Log in to CourtReserve and confirm you're viewing the correct club you want to subscribe to.

  2. On the top-right, click your Name.

  3. Click Calendar Feed. Example below:

  4. Select from the following options:

    1. Copy Link - Copies the calendar feed URL to your clipboard, allowing you to paste it into your calendar program.

    2. Get File - Downloads a calendar (.ics) file to your computer for manual upload into your calendar program.

    3. Email Link - Sends the calendar feed URL to your email address on file.


Already have your Calendar Feed URL? Here's what to do next:

The easiest way to add your CourtReserve calendar feed is to copy the link to your clipboard by selecting Copy Link.


Your clipboard is a temporary space where your computer or device stores things you've copied. Once the link is copied, you can paste it into your calendar application without having to retype it.

To paste the link, you can usually right-click your mouse (on a computer) or press and hold your finger (on a phone or tablet) where you want to place it, then select Paste from the menu that appears.

Open your calendar application and follow its instructions for adding external calendars or feeds. Since each platform has a unique setup that can change over time, we’ve provided links to the most common calendar types below for easy reference. Within each of these options, you will be "pasting" in your copied URL from CourtReserve.
